What Does 100 Year Flood Plain Mean. 100-year flood plain means the line that corresponds to the limit line of a flood likely to occur once. Areas within the 100-year floodplain may flood in much smaller storms as well. Is my property in the 100-Year Floodplain and what does that mean. This also means it can flood more than once within a 100-year period and can even flood more than once in the same year.

The 100-year flood zone is actually a designated area that has a 1-in-100 chance or 1 chance of flooding in any given year. These zones are shown in detail on. 100-year flood plain means the area inundated during the pas- sage of a flood with a peak discharge having a one percent chance of being equaled or exceeded in any given year at a specified location on a watercourse.
